Developing Customer Relationships That Result in Action
In today's dynamic marketplace, simply having a great product or service isn't enough. To truly thrive, businesses need to prioritize building lasting relationships with their customers. These connections are the foundation for loyalty and repeat business, consequently leading to increased sales and growth. Consider how to foster customer relationships that yield tangible results.
* **Truly Hear Your Customers:** Understanding your customers' needs, wants, and pain points is paramount. Communicate with them through surveys, feedback forms, and social check here media to acquire valuable insights.
* **Personalize the Experience:** Generic interactions lack impact. Demonstrate your customers that you value them as individuals by customizing their experience. This could include sending personalized recommendations, birthday greetings, or exclusive content.
* **Provide Exceptional Customer Service:** When customers encounter issues, be responsive. Solve their problems quickly and go the extra mile to exceed expectations.
Remember that nurturing strong customer relationships is a continuous process. By investing time and effort, you can create a loyal customer base that will drive your business's success.
Steering the Sales Funnel with Precision
Every company aims to maximize its sales results. A well-defined and effectively managed sales funnel is vital to achieving this goal.
It's a systematic process that leads potential customers through various stages, from first awareness to the final acquisition. To triumphantly navigate this funnel and land more opportunities, businesses must adopt a range of approaches.
One important aspect is to analyze the specific needs and pain points of your target demographic. This insight allows you to adapt your messaging and services to appeal with them on a more personal level.
Another fundamental step is to create compelling content that provide value to your market. This could comprise blog posts, {infographics|visuals|data], ebooks, webinars, or any other channel that engages their attention.
By consistently providing high-quality content, you can foster yourself as a trusted source in your sector. This increases your standing and makes it more likely for prospects to consider your company when they are prepared to make a purchase.
Finally, it's important to analyze the results of your sales funnel and implement necessary modifications based on the data you collect. This could comprise A/B testing different strategies, optimizing your website for conversions, or refining your sales workflow. By regularly evaluating and optimizing your funnel, you can guarantee that it is running as efficiently as possible.
